1.4 Key Principles
This document is the "SESAR Maturity Report Executive Summary". The maturity is captured through Release Systems Engineering Reviews and ad-hoc assessments based on latest information available to the OFA Coordinators or the SJU.
Since this status was captured, for some OI steps, it may happen that maturity has changed compared to the results which are reflected in the “SESAR Maturity Report”. In this case, these new assessments results will feed next versions of the “SESAR Maturity Report”.
The “SESAR Maturity Report” is to be understood as reflecting the current and known status of the overall "SESAR maturity". It will more accurately reflect SESAR maturity over time, once new results are achieved within the Programme and assessments made available. SESAR maturity will be reviewed periodically by SJU after main Systems Engineering Reviews (on a basis of twice a year). Following the same process, new versions of this SESAR Maturity Report will be issued, in order to update the current "SESAR maturity ",
The “SESAR Maturity Report” provides a shared and common reference for SESAR Solutions and OI steps maturity (SESAR maturity baseline) and provides a controlled way to make this reference change.
The SESAR maturity baseline reported makes use of assessments that have been made available through Release Systems Engineering Reviews or have been provided by OFA Coordinators, as well as assumptions based on the information declared in the Validation and Verification Roadmap. SESAR Members are invited to review the SESAR maturity baseline and in case of variance, to provide evidence of the maturity of SESAR Solutions / OI steps.

1.6 Assumptions
The principles to assess SESAR Solution / OI step maturity are described in the document “MAT Report Principles and Layout”. However, for SESAR Solutions / OI steps declared to be in a particular validation phase (e.g. V3) and for which there were no assessments available from the previous validation phases, then it was assumed that previous validation phases were satisfactorily achieved (e.g. V1 and V2).

2 Background
2.1 Maturity Assessment Process
The assessment of SESAR Solutions / OI steps is based on SESAR Programme Management Plan (Edition 03.00.02). SESAR PMP provides a high level description of the process to assess and determine the degree of maturity of the SESAR concept definition.
Maturity assessment takes place along the Programme lifecycle on a yearly basis, as part of three Release management process:
Extended Release Strategy definition, to identify and plan the future activities needed for the SESAR Solutions / OI steps to achieve end of V3;
Release Systems Engineering Review 1, to confirm the V2 maturity of SESAR Solutions / OI steps using the results of the exercises preceding the proposed V3 exercises candidates;
Release Systems Engineering Review 3, to confirm the V3 maturity of SESAR Solutions / OI steps using the Release exercise results.
Maturity Assessment should also be undertaken by projects working on a given OFA along their development process.

3.4 Enabling Capabilities
Future editions of the Maturity Report will include an assessment of the maturity of Technological Solutions based on Technology Readiness Level criteria (TRL). Technology that enables future SESAR Solutions, verified as feasible, safe and to provide Performance Improvements is considered to be a “Technological Solution”.
Four Technological Solutions have been initially proposed for Release 5:
Airport Surface Data Link (AeroMACS)
